What to check before choosing a building with rent-stabilized apartments near the Staten Island Railway in Port Richmond

  • Use the rent-stabilized filter as your baseline, then treat “near SIR-train” as a commute check: confirm the exact stop and walk time at the times you’d actually travel.
  • Before you tour, ask how rent-regulation rules show up for current tenants (renewal expectations, allowable increases, and any documentation they reference).
  • Check the lease terms that apply to each unit: rent-stabilized status can still vary by unit history, and some buildings require specific renewal or paperwork steps.
  • Expect common building paperwork and move-in requirements: request the full list of fees and deposits up front so you can budget beyond the asking rent.
  • If a building looks available now, verify what’s actually in the unit: ask about floor plan, appliances, and any condition items noted by staff versus what’s shown online.
